BVB – Lucien Favre talks about Borussia Dortmund: “Pictimile mistake”

After a 1-5 home defeat against VfB Stuttgart in mid-December 2020, Lucien Favre will be released as a coach of Borussia Dortmund. More than a year later, the Swiss now expresses itself over his BVB.

“It’s a pity, because we have previously qualified for the Champions League, there have been a group player there, and three days later it is 1: 1 against Stuttgart,” Favre described the then BVB situation in an interview with the French L ‘Equipe.

After that, the Dortmunds were crowded. “We make miserable mistakes and it was beat on blow. After a while you have to accept it with it. You always try to correct the mistakes, but it’s difficult,” Favre told.

A discharge had been almost altableless afterwards. He does not fail the BVB leadership against him. “Then I understand it. It’s Dortmund, you lose at home 1: 5…”

Nevertheless, he would be more than satisfied with his time in Dortmund. In the two and a half years, in which he led the sporty skills with the chat yellow, the club has been “qualified three times for the Champions League three times, was twice second against the Bavarians, which were inexorably at that time.”

Favre: Haaland “A great transfer”

The transfer of striker Erling Haaland was one of his great successes during the BVB time. “He has so much strength when he goes into the depth between the two domestic defenders, they can not stop him anymore. He has made great progress, he is a great worker with a great mentality and someone who always wants to win. It was always A great transfer, “Walking Favre from the young Norwegian.

Haaland had to fit the release of Favres because of a muscle faser. That too did not necessarily help: “He had become indispensable and was injured in the time I went away.”

Favre led between July 2018 and December 2020 the Dortmund team as head coach. Previously, he had already been active in the Bundesliga for Hertha BSC (2007-2009) and Borussia Mönchengladbach (2011-2015).
